MINGHELLA'S LAST FILM PREMIERES IN LONDON

The premiere of ANTHONY MINGHELLA's final film went ahead on Tuesday night (18Mar08), just hours after it was announced the director had died. TV movie The No. 1 Ladies' Detective Agency was screened at the "very moving" and "bitter-sweet" London event after Minghella's family insisted the premiere go-ahead. The British filmmaker, who the won Best Director Oscar for his 1996 movie The English Patient, died from complications following surgery for cancer of the tonsils and neck, which he underwent last week (end14Mar08) at London's Charing Cross Hospital. He was 54-years-old.
